In this unique performing and visual art workshop, students are introduced to theatre basics including: respect for one another and for the performance space, working together, preparedness for a role, and how one rehearses and performs a play. Students will leave a little braver, more creative, with a new passion, and new friends and fun memories!
Taught by long-time friend of the theatre Julia Wilson and held at the Mallardi Theatre, this theatre camp will appeal to emerging artists and performers who are ready to expand their skills!

More About our Camp Director
Julia Wilson has enjoyed directing and costuming children’s musicals at the Gunnison Arts Center (GAC), including Oliver, The Hobbit and The Wizard of Oz, and more recently wrote and directed her own musical version of The Velveteen Rabbit for both children and adults. In summer 2021, she supervised the GAC’s summer theatre camp and directed a workshop production of Don’t Count Your Chickens Until They Cry Wolf. She also has directed and costumed Into the Woods, L'il Abner and Anything Goes at the Gunnison High School. One of her favorite things has been playing the piano for several Missoula Children’s Theater productions at the GAC. Over the last year, she has been helping the Crested Butte Mountain Theatre with props and costumes.
